Starter: A Monster-Battling LitRPG
"Tame. Train. Battle. Fans of Pokémon, Digimon, and Monster Rancher love this monster-battling series! Jackson Hunt wants nothing more than to be a professional monster tamer - skilled trainers who raise and battle magical creatures called Djinn. He longs for the day when he comes of age and can leave home to pursue his dreams of taming Djinn. Unfortunately for Jackson, dreams and reality don’t always coincide. To help his grandmother make ends meet, Jackson spends his days doing manual labor on a breeder’s ranch - just about as far removed from the bright lights and roaring crowds of the DBL (Djinn Battle League) as it gets. But no matter how hard Jackson and his grandma try, it’s never enough. Facing bank foreclosure, Jackson is desperate to save his home but has no idea how…until he discovers a young, untrained Djinn left behind for him by his dead mother. As time runs out, Jackson works tirelessly to raise and develop a bond with his Djinn. But monster taming isn’t as easy as the pros make it look. Along the way, Jackson and his friends will delve into the shady world of underground fighting, experience the agony of defeat and learn what it takes to be a true monster tamer. Will Jackson and his Djinn level up fast enough or is his dream destined to die before it even truly begins? ©2019 Joseph Antonio Medina and Derek Alan Siddoway (P)2019 Aethon Books"

Rivals: A Monster Battling LitRPG
"Let the rivalries begin. If Jackson Hunt ever wants to become a champion monster trainer, he’s got a long road ahead of him. And he’s not the only one with dreams of glory. As a new season of the Djinn Battle League fast approaches, Jackson prepares to enter training camp - a grueling series of tests to discover talented new tamers. The rules are simple: If you’re not the best, you go home. For a young man who lives to battle, going home isn’t an option. There’s only one problem - Jackson isn’t so sure he deserves to be there in the first place. With competition heating up, Jackson’s bond with his Djinn will be tested to their limits. But no matter how much he trains, if his new monsters won’t work together, he won’t stand a chance. The fighting will be intense. The rivalries, fierce. At the end of the road, the chance of a lifetime awaits. Against friends and foes both old and new, can Jackson prove he’s worthy of a shot at the big leagues? Djinn Tamer: Rivals is the second book in the Djinn Tamer series, a monster-battling LitRPG for fans of Pokemon, Digimon, and Monster Rancher. ©2019 Joseph Antonio Medina and Derek Alan Siddoway (P)2019 Aethon Audio"

Evolution: A Monster Battling LitRPG
"Welcome to the big leagues. It’s time to crown a champion. It’s time to evolve. Jackson Hunt has spent countless hours training his team of monsters and battling rivals as an up and coming Djinn Tamer. All his hard work, the stunning wins, and heartbreaking losses lead to one place: The league playoffs. But what got Jackson where he is won’t be enough to take him to the top. As the season draws to a close, Jackson and his friends find themselves far away from the stadiums and crowds, searching for a means to take his Djinn to the next level. The strength he seeks lies in a remote, untamed corner of the world, where myth and legend walk hand in hand. Competition for the championship will be fierce and the dangers of the wild are only the beginning. Is Jackson ready for the biggest battle of his young career? Skills will be tested, new powers unleashed. Victory won’t come without a cost. Evolution is the third book in Djinn Tamer, a monster battling, LitRPG adventure series for fans of Pokemon, Digimon, and Monster Rancher. ©2019 Derek Alan Siddoway, Joseph Antonio Medina (P)2020 Aethon Audio"
